我似乎无法让RewriteRule生效 - 它只是不匹配。
我的网址:http://www.example.com/users/username/articles/2012/03/12/article-title.php
我的.htaccess代码:
RewriteEngine On
RewriteRule ^users/([a-zA-Z0-9]+)/articles/$ article.php?url=/users/$1/articles/$2 [L]
答案 0 :(得分:1)
您列出的RewriteRule仅捕获以“articles /”结尾的网址。你需要添加一些东西来捕获文本的其余部分,比如(。*),给你
RewriteRule ^users/([a-zA-Z0-9]+)/articles/(.*)$ article.php?url=/users/$1/articles/$2 [L]